Pilot poultry project hatches in Hay River

 
Dealing with the high cost of food in the North is a constant challenge for producers and consumers. Through innovation and new thinking, Choice North Farms in Hay River is hoping to make a difference by undertaking the PoultryPonics Dome Project, supported with over $80,000 of CanNor funding.
 
The announcement was made today by Michael McLeod, Member of Parliament (Northwest Territories) on behalf of the Honourable Navdeep Bains, Minister of Innovation, Science and Economic Development and Minister responsible for CanNor.
 
Choice North Farms is a private egg producing company in Hay River. Their pilot project will integrate vertical hydroponic units and poultry production in a small geodesic dome. This combination will reduce the amount of nutrients and energy required for production, while providing a good supply of quality local fresh produce and meat substitutes.
 
If the pilot project is successful, this innovative clean technology could be scaled and adapted in other Northern communities, promoting economic diversification, reducing the cost of living, and enhancing the quality of life in remote communities.
